Transaction 86867cadf538b6728f77b33995aedd9125ab3a8750e9ca3711727ef878344341
1 Input
1 Output
-
86867cadf538b6728f77b33995aedd9125ab3a8750e9ca3711727ef878344341:0
- value
- 38226
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b35560d64bd526d30d2b5ded080aa0554cbe7eb
- address
- bc1qpv64vrtyh4fx6vxjkh0dpq92q42vheltca9jcp